When people hear the terms AI and GPT, they often think they’re the same thing. But while they’re connected, they’re not interchangeable—and understanding the difference is key to unlocking the tech of tomorrow.
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is the big umbrella. It refers to machines designed to think, learn, and adapt like humans—or better. From your smart thermostat to facial recognition on your phone, AI is all around you.
GPT (Generative Pre-trained Transformer), on the other hand, is a specific kind of AI that focuses on language. It powers tools like ChatGPT, writing assistants, and intelligent chatbots. It’s trained on massive amounts of data and learns how to respond, write, explain, and even create.
